The Parliament of New Zealand enacts as follows:
1 Title
This Act is the District Courts Amendment Act 2013.
2 Commencement
(1)
If section 22(1) of the District Courts Amendment Act 2011 is not in force on the date on which this Act receives the Royal assent, section 5 comes into force on the commencement of section 22(1) of that Act.
(2)
If section 22(1) of the District Courts Amendment Act 2011 is in force on the date on which this Act receives the Royal assent, section 5 comes into force on the day after that date.
(3)
The rest of this Act comes into force on the day after the date on which it receives the Royal assent.
Section 2(1): section 5 brought into force, on 14 April 2014, pursuant to the District Courts Amendment Act 2011 Commencement Order 2013 (SR 2013/410).
3 Principal Act
This Act amends the District Courts Act 1947 (the principal Act).
4 Section 80 amended (Enforcement of judgments more than 6 years old)
After section 80(1), insert:
(1A)
A judgment that is an arbitral award entered as a judgment is more than 6 years old for the purposes of this section if 6 years have elapsed since the date on which the award became enforceable by action in New Zealand.
5 Section 84N amended (Review of Registrar’s decision)
In section 84N(1) (as amended by section 22(1) of the District Courts Amendment Act 2011), replace “section 84C or section 84E”
with “section 84EA or section 84EC”

Reprints notes
1 General
This is a reprint of the District Courts Amendment Act 2013 that incorporates all the amendments to that Act as at the date of the last amendment to it.
2 Legal status
Reprints are presumed to correctly state, as at the date of the reprint, the law enacted by the principal enactment and by any amendments to that enactment. Section 18 of the Legislation Act 2012 provides that this reprint, published in electronic form, has the status of an official version under section 17 of that Act. A printed version of the reprint produced directly from this official electronic version also has official status.
3 Editorial and format changes
Editorial and format changes to reprints are made using the powers under sections 24 to 26 of the Legislation Act 2012. See also http://www.pco.parliament.govt.nz/editorial-conventions/.
